😐Monthly costs for one person with rent: $1,977 in Bad Säckingen versus $1,392 in Ubud, Bali.
😐Estimated couple costs with rent: $3,000 in Bad Säckingen versus $2,557 in Ubud, Bali.
😐Monthly costs for a family of three with rent: $4,024 in Bad Säckingen versus $3,723 in Ubud, Bali.
🌍Living in Bad Säckingen is roughly 42% more expensive than in Ubud, Bali, driven mainly by Eating Out.
📊Both cities are pricier than the global median: Bad Säckingen49% above, Ubud, Bali5% above.
